Background

Forestry England is delivering a digital transformation programme that ‘Places customers at the heart of Forestry England and facilitates the use of digital means to truly connect people with the nation’s forests.’

The digital transformation is enabled by the Connections platform which is built on Salesforce technology.

Connections is delivered by the CRM Programme Project Team – a group of capable individuals with a combination of business analysis & design, technology implementation, Salesforce expertise, and change management skills.

The CRM Programme Project Team continue to develop important solutions that will help the organisation improve its customer engagement, customer service and effectiveness

Purpose

A key solution area is Salesforce Marketing Cloud. This is critical functionality which enables the engagement with the community that Forestry England considers as its customers.

Salesforce Marketing Cloud has been recently implemented into the overall solution architecture, and the marketing team will be using the solution extensively to create campaigns, newsletters, and other engaging marketing communications.

This role of Marketing Cloud Specialist will provide the relevant functional and technical skills to support the marketing team with their various strategies utilising Salesforce Marketing Cloud. For this role you will have 3-5 years of specific experience in configuring and developing Salesforce Marketing Cloud solutions, as well as good knowledge and understanding of the Salesforce platform and other solutions such as Sales Cloud.

Working for the Civil Service…

Forestry England is part of the Civil Service. The Civil Service has a Disability Confident Scheme (DCS). This means candidates with disabilities who meet the minimum selection criteria during the application process will be guaranteed an interview. We also offer a Redeployment Interview Scheme to current civil servants who are at risk of redundancy, and who meet the minimum requirements for the role. This role is also part of the Great Place to Work for Veterans and Prison Leaver Recruitment initiative.

Within Part 7 of the Immigration Act 2016, it is essential that applicants should have the ability to provide conversation in accurate spoken English.

Our recruitment process makes appointments based on fair and open competition and merit, as outlined in the Civil Service Commissioners’ Recruitment Principles.
